Barbara Marten

Barbara Marten

Birthday: 1947-01-03

Place of Birth: Leeds, United Kingdom

Biography: Barbara Marten is a British actress. She is most known for playing 'Eve Montgomery' in Casualty. She has appeared in various soaps, including Eastenders and Brookside, as well as many other drama serials such as Harry, The Bill and Band of Gold.
